When recognizing that a client has received an electrical shock, the nurse will:
 
  A. Go to get help
  B. Start CPR
  C. Ask the client to assist in moving away from the source of the shock
  D. Assess for the presence of a pulse

Answer to Question 1

D
D. If client receives an electrical shock, immediately assess the presence of a pulse. Electrical shock can cause cardiac arrest, asystole.
A. Do not leave the client. Assess for a pulse. Electrical shock can cause cardiac arrest, asystole.
B. If client is pulseless, institute cardiopulmonary resuscitation.
C. If client has a pulse and remains alert and oriented, obtain vital signs and assess the skin for signs of thermal injury. Electrical current will cause burns at points of entry and exit from the body.
